#include "core/events/GestureEvent.h"
#include "core/dom/Element.h"
#include "wtf/text/AtomicString.h"
namespace blink {
GestureEvent* GestureEvent::create(AbstractView* view,
const WebGestureEvent& event) {
AtomicString eventType;
switch (event.type()) {
case WebInputEvent::GestureScrollBegin: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turescrollstart;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ureScrollEnd: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turescrollend;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ureScrollUpdate: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turescrollupdate;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ureTap: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turetap;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ureTapUnconfirmed: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turetapunconfirmed;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ureTapDown: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turetapdown;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ureShowPress: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gestureshowpress;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ureLongPress: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gesturelongpress;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ureFlingStart:
eventType = EventTypeNames::gestureflingstart;
break;
case WebInputEvent::GestureTwoFingerTap:
case WebInputEvent::GesturePinchBegin:
case WebInputEvent::GesturePinchEnd:
case WebInputEvent::GesturePinchUpdate:
case WebInputEvent::GestureTapCancel:
default:
return nullptr;
}
return new GestureEvent(eventType, view, event);
}
GestureEvent::GestureEvent(const AtomicString& eventType,
AbstractView* view,
const WebGestureEvent& event)
: UIEventWithKeyState(
eventType,
true,
true,
view,
0,
static_cast<PlatformEvent::Modifiers>(event.modifiers()),
TimeTicks::FromSeconds(event.timeStampSeconds()),
nullptr),
m_nativeEvent(event) {}
const AtomicString& GestureEvent::interfaceName() const {
// FIXME: when a GestureEvent.idl interface is defined, return the string
// "GestureEvent". Until that happens, do not advertise an interface that
// does not exist, since it will trip up the bindings integrity checks.
return UIEvent::interfaceName();
}
bool GestureEvent::isGestureEvent() const {
return true;
}
DEFINE_TRACE(GestureEvent) {
UIEvent::trace(visitor);
}
} // namespace blink
